How Roofing Ventilation Functions



Reliable roof air flow counts on the all-natural motion of air to create an equilibrium between consumption and exhaust. When you set up vents, you're basically permitting fresh air to enter your attic while allowing warm, stagnant air to leave. This procedure assists regulate temperature and dampness levels, avoiding issues like mold growth and roof covering damage.

Consumption vents, commonly found at the eaves, reel in amazing air from outside. On the other hand, exhaust vents, situated near the ridge of the roofing, let hot air increase and exit. The distinction in temperature develops a natural air movement, referred to as the pile effect. As cozy air rises, it develops a vacuum that pulls in cooler air from the lower vents.

To optimize this system, you require to make certain that the consumption and exhaust vents are properly sized and positioned. If the intake is restricted, you won't achieve the preferred air flow.

Furthermore, not enough exhaust can catch warm and wetness, resulting in possible damages.
